Stationary Engineer Pennsylvania Class A License Preferred
Schedule is Wednesday through Sunday 3rd Shift
Maintains and operates stationary steam boilers, pumps, and related equipment such as water softeners, air compressors, water treatment systems, and associated piping, chillers, tower, and auxiliary systems.
Performs daily chemical water treatment of the boilers to ensure proper running of equipment.
Abides by and enforces all safety rules and regulations, State and local, in order to keep the boiler house safe.
Responsible for keeping the boiler house and immediate surrounding area clean and up to Jefferson's facilities standards.
Occasionally required to perform general mechanical and minor electrical/HVAC work in support of the Facilities department and local building needs.
Interacts with co-workers, visitors, and other staff consistent with the values of Jefferson New Job Description.
Operates and maintains boilers as well as chiller and auxiliary systems by reading meters/pressure gauges and taking necessary appropriate action to ensure safe operation.
Repacks valves, changes piping, and lubricates compressors, pumps, and related parts on a regular basis.
Starts, stops, adjusts, and regulates boilers and associated equipment as necessary to insure efficiency and continuity of service.
Cleans boilers, waterside, and fire side, annually or as required, to meet code and regulation requirements.
Performs daily inspection of boilers, pipelines, and operating equipment for steam, water, air, and fuel leaks or defective parts.
Maintains record of gages and meter readings to determine fuel and steam consumption, steam produced, hot water, and chilled/condensed water temperature, chiller operating pressure, etc.
Consults with and keeps Lead/Chief Stationary Engineers apprised of activities, needs, and issues as they arise.
Performs other maintenance needs as required and directed by the supervisor or lead technician.
